Burraand its attractions for luxury travelers

Burra, South Australia, offers a unique blend of history and luxury that will delight discerning travellers. Begin your exploration at the historic Burra Mine, where you can embark on guided tours that delve into the rich mining heritage of the area, providing fascinating insights into the town's past. For a touch of nature, the picturesque Burra Creek Gorge is perfect for leisurely walks, with stunning views and opportunities for wildlife spotting, ideal for families looking to bond in the great outdoors. Art enthusiasts will appreciate the local galleries showcasing the works of talented Australian artists; a visit here could be a perfect afternoon outing, followed by a fine dining experience at one of Burra's exquisite restaurants serving locally sourced cuisine. Don't miss the chance to explore the nearby Clare Valley wine region, where you can indulge in wine tastings and gourmet food experiences, ensuring your palate is as pampered as your stay. When can I expect good weather in Burra?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Burra rel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are August and July, with an average of 10°C. Average annual precipitation for Burra is 391 mm.
What's there to see and do in Burra?
Enjoy Burra with a stop at Market Square, Redruth Gaol and Burra Miner's Dugouts. If you have spare time during your trip, you might want to make a stop at Burra Mine Site Grassland and Kotz Cottage.
